Key Takeaway

Lexar's Muse portable SSD is an ultra-slim drive (3.8mm thick) using a proprietary SnapLink magnetic pogo-pin cable. It offers read speeds up to 1,050 MB/s and write up to 1,000 MB/s. The drive can be used with a magnetic sleeve for phone attachment. Available in 512GB and 1TB capacities in Q4 2026. No price announced. The design sacrifices a standard USB-C port for slimness.

Samsung Leads NAND Market as Prices Climb 55% in a Single Quarter

Counterpoint Research data shows the global NAND market grew 70% QoQ in Q2, with prices climbing 55% due to AI server stockpiling. Samsung holds 28% revenue share, followed by SK hynix (19%) and Micron (15%). YMTC grew to 14% share. Price stabilization is expected in 2027.

Lenovo ThinkCentre X Ultra packs Gorgon Halo — AMD Ryzen AI Max+ Pro 495 shows up in mini workstation

Lenovo reveals the ThinkCentre X Ultra, a compact mini workstation (7.2x7.2x2 inches) with up to AMD Ryzen AI Max+ Pro 495 (Gorgon Halo) and integrated Radeon 8065S GPU. It supports up to 128GB soldered LPDDR5x-8533, dual M.2 Gen5 SSDs, and offers Thunderbolt 4, 10Gb Ethernet, and DisplayPort 2.1. Price starts at $3,699, available November 2026. Can be clustered for AI workloads.
